Rio de Janeiro coast is full of beautiful beaches, such as Arraial do Cabo where Farol Beach is.
The Beach is one of the most beautiful in Brazil and amazes for its perfect landscape. The great sand dunes perfectly adorn the centenary fig tree and the turquoise sea, delighting tourists.
Located in an ecological reserve, the waters of Farol Beach are crystal clear and cold. The best way to make the most of your visit is to bathe in or snorkel with a mask to see colourful fishes in this natural aquarium.
In the region there are archaeological sites and historical ruins such as Farol Novo (New Farol) and Farol Velho (Old Farol).
The only way to get to Farol Beach is by boat and you must have an authorization issue by the Instituto de Estudos do Mar Almirante Paulo Moreira (IEAPM) (Study of the Sea Almirante Paulo Moreira Institute).

You can only get to the beach by boat. In Arraial do Cabo there are many tourim agencies that make this trip.
